Abstract

The invention discloses a remote real-time monitoring system of an LED streetlight, comprising a preposed switch, a terminal controller and a microcomputer terminal which are sequentially connected, wherein the preposed switch comprises an optoelectronic isolator and a high-speed optical coupling isolator; the terminal controller comprises an alarm, a dialing circuit and a voice circuit which arerespectively connected with a second microprocessor, wherein the voice circuit stores alarm sound recordings; the second microprocessor comprises an alarm module; and the alarm module is used for receiving measurement data from the preposed switch through a second interface circuit, alarming through the alarm when discovering that alarm is needed after processing the measurement data, dialing a preset telephone number through the dialing circuit when a processed signal of the alarm is not received within preset time and playing the alarm sound recordings stored in the voice circuit to the telephone number. The invention has the advantages of low cost, reliability, stability, obviously enhanced anti-interference capability.

technical field [0001] The invention relates to the technical field of monitoring, in particular to a remote real-time monitoring system for LED street lamps. Background technique [0002] At present, with the rapid development of urbanization, a large number of street lights are required. Street lighting is an important part of urban construction. It plays an important role in saving electricity and energy, strengthening urban management, and enhancing citizen satisfaction. The existing problems in lighting energy-saving management include: how to reduce the energy consumption of street lamps; how to effectively manage the lighting network system; how to deal with the increasingly large management and maintenance costs. [0003] The three-remote (remote measurement, remote signal, remote control) technology of street lighting using electronic ballasts is one of the effective ways to solve the above problems and improve the power management level of the power system.
